Yakima – More Than Just a Rack

Born in the beautiful, adventure-rich Pacific Northwest of the United States, Yakima has been a go-to for outdoors enthusiasts since 1979. They've built a reputation on quality and durability, with a comprehensive range of racks to fit almost any vehicle.

What problem does Yakima solve?

The brand is all about enhancing outdoor experiences. They specialize in roof racks, bike racks, and cargo boxes that handle the roughest terrains and longest journeys. Yakima's 'Plug and Play' technology makes assembly and disassembly effortless, freeing up more time for your adventure.

Who are Yakima racks for?

In short, the hardcore outdoor lovers. Yakima's heavy-duty construction is perfect for people who regularly go biking, skiing, or camping. If your adventures are varied and often involve rugged conditions, Yakima has your back.

Prorack – Clever, Affordable, and Efficient

Prorack, hailing from New Zealand, is the brainchild of Hubco Automotive, a leader in the automotive industry for over 30 years. Prorack is all about practicality and value.

Prorack's magic lies in their innovative designs. Their problem-solving approach is all about space – maximizing your vehicle's load capacity without compromising safety or fuel efficiency. Prorack's versatile roof racks and customizable accessories ensure that every inch of space is used wisely.

Who is Prorack for? It's for the family going on a holiday, the surfer hitting the beach, or the everyday commuter. If you need a reliable, cost-effective solution that's easy to install and remove, Prorack is your brand.
